The Asics GT-2000 15 is designed for adult male runners seeking a reliable balance of stability and cushioning for daily training. Its key benefit lies in the updated midsole technology that provides a noticeably softer and more responsive ride, making it ideal for those who need extra arch support. A notable caveat for potential buyers is that the specialized stability features are best suited for runners who specifically require guided foot movement rather than a neutral, minimalist feel.

FAQs

Are these shoes suitable for high-arch feet?

The GT-2000 15 is primarily a stability shoe designed for overpronation. While comfortable, high-arch runners may prefer a shoe with more neutral cushioning.

How do I know if I need a stability shoe?

If you notice that your ankles roll inward when you run or if you wear down the inside edge of your outsoles quickly, you likely benefit from stability features like those found in the GT-2000 15.

Can I replace the insoles with custom orthotics?

Yes, the stock insoles are removable, allowing you to insert your own custom orthotics if preferred.

How often should I replace these trainers?

Generally, running shoes should be replaced every 300 to 500 miles, depending on your running surface and body weight.

Are these effective for trail running?

These shoes are optimized for road and pavement surfaces; the outsole grip may not provide sufficient traction on loose dirt or technical trails.

Does the FF BLAST MAX foam lose its bounce over time?

Like all midsole foams, it will eventually compress, but the FF BLAST MAX is engineered for durability and longevity.

Troubleshooting

Feeling pressure on the top of the foot

Loosen the laces across the midfoot or try a different lacing pattern, such as skipping the eyelets directly over the pressure point.

Heel slippage while running

Use the extra top eyelet to create a heel lock loop, which secures the ankle collar more firmly against your heel.

Upper material appearing dusty or stained

Use a soft-bristled brush to remove dried dirt, then spot clean with a cloth dampened with cool water.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

To ensure the longevity of your Asics GT-2000 15 trainers, start by ensuring you have the correct size; Asics trainers should provide about a thumb's width of space between your longest toe and the front of the shoe. When fitting, use the top eyelet for a 'runner's knot' if you experience heel slippage. For care, avoid machine washing or tumble drying, as this can break down the structural integrity of the cushioning and adhesive. Instead, wipe them down with a damp cloth and mild soap after muddy runs and let them air dry in a well-ventilated area away from direct heat sources.
